Qu'est-ce que la décimale codée binaire (BCD) ?
Le BCD est un système de représentation numérique dans lequel chaque chiffre décimal est codé à l'aide de quatre chiffres binaires. Il est couramment utilisé dans les systèmes numériques où des opérations arithmétiques décimales sont nécessaires.
Quel est l'avantage de l'utilisation du BCD ?
L'avantage du BCD est sa capacité à représenter les nombres décimaux avec précision, ce qui est important dans de nombreuses applications, telles que les calculs financiers, le chronométrage et les systèmes de mesure. Le BCD permet également une conversion facile entre les représentations binaires et décimales.
Quelle est la différence entre le BCD et le binaire ?
Le binaire n'utilise que deux chiffres (0 et 1) pour représenter les nombres, tandis que le BCD utilise quatre chiffres binaires pour représenter chaque chiffre décimal (0 à 9). Le binaire est moins encombrant et plus facile à traiter, mais il ne peut pas représenter les nombres décimaux avec précision sans traitement supplémentaire.
Quelle est la valeur maximale qui peut être représentée en BCD ?
En BCD, la valeur décimale maximale représentée à l'aide de quatre chiffres binaires est 9. La valeur maximale représentée à l'aide de huit chiffres binaires (deux chiffres BCD) est 99.
Quelles sont les applications courantes du BCD ?
Le BCD est couramment utilisé dans les systèmes numériques qui nécessitent une arithmétique décimale précise, tels que les calculatrices, les caisses enregistreuses et les systèmes de comptabilité. Il est également utilisé dans les circuits d'horloge en temps réel et les systèmes de mesure.
Comment le BCD est-il utilisé en programmation ?
En programmation, le BCD est souvent utilisé dans les opérations arithmétiques décimales, telles que l'addition, la soustraction, la multiplication et la division. Certains processeurs disposent d'un support intégré pour l'arithmétique BCD, tandis que d'autres requièrent des algorithmes logiciels pour effectuer des calculs BCD.
Qu'est-ce que la conversion de code BCD ?
La conversion de code BCD consiste à convertir un nombre d'une représentation BCD à une autre. Cette opération est généralement effectuée pour passer d'un format BCD à un autre ou pour convertir un nombre BCD en un nombre binaire ou vice-versa.
Quelle est la différence entre le BCD non condensé et le BCD condensé ?
Le BCD non condensé utilise un octet (huit bits) pour représenter chaque chiffre décimal, tandis que le BCD condensé utilise quatre bits pour représenter chaque chiffre décimal. Le BCD empaqueté est plus efficace en termes d'espace mais nécessite un traitement supplémentaire pour convertir le BCD non empaqueté en BCD empaqueté.
Comment le BCD est-il utilisé dans les horloges numériques ?
Le BCD est souvent utilisé dans les circuits d'horloge numérique pour afficher l'heure actuelle. Un circuit d'horloge en temps réel utilise un oscillateur à cristal pour générer un signal d'horloge stable, qui est ensuite divisé pour produire un signal d'horloge à une fréquence inférieure. Ce signal d'horloge est ensuite utilisé pour incrémenter un ensemble de compteurs qui enregistrent le temps au format BCD.
Quelle est la différence entre le code BCD et le code ASCII (American Standard Code for Information Interchange) ?
Le code BCD est un système de représentation numérique utilisé pour représenter les chiffres décimaux, tandis que le code ASCII est un système de codage de caractères utilisé pour représenter les lettres, les symboles et les autres caractères utilisés dans les communications textuelles.
Comment le BCD est-il utilisé pour le stockage des données ?
Dans certaines applications, le BCD est utilisé pour stocker des données numériques de manière compacte et efficace. Par exemple, un mot de 16 bits peut être utilisé pour stocker quatre chiffres BCD, ce qui permet de représenter jusqu'à 10^8 valeurs uniques à l'aide de deux mots.
Quelle est la différence entre le code BCD et le code gris ?
Le code gris est un système de numération binaire dans lequel les valeurs successives ne diffèrent que d'un bit. Le code BCD, quant à lui, est un système de numération décimale dans lequel chaque chiffre décimal est représenté à l'aide de quatre chiffres binaires. Le code Gray est souvent utilisé dans les systèmes numériques pour minimiser les erreurs causées par les transitions entre deux valeurs adjacentes.
Quel est l'objectif de la correction BCD ?
La correction BCD est un processus utilisé pour corriger les erreurs qui peuvent survenir lors de la conversion entre les représentations binaires et BCD. La correction BCD consiste à ajuster la valeur binaire pour s'assurer qu'elle représente une valeur BCD valide.
Quelle est la différence entre le code BCD et le code excess-3 ?
Le code Excess-3, également connu sous le nom de 8421BCD, est une variante du code BCD dans laquelle chaque chiffre décimal est représenté en lui ajoutant 3 avant de l'encoder en binaire. Cela signifie que le code pour le chiffre 0 est 0011 au lieu de 0000, et ainsi de suite. Le code Excess-3 peut être utilisé pour détecter les erreurs dans les transmissions BCD.
Quel est l'avantage d'utiliser le BCD dans les calculs financiers ?
L'avantage de l'utilisation du BCD dans les calculs financiers est sa capacité à représenter les nombres décimaux avec précision et à éviter les erreurs d'arrondi qui peuvent se produire lors de l'utilisation de la représentation binaire. C'est important dans les calculs financiers, où la précision est cruciale.
En quoi l'arithmétique BCD diffère-t-elle de l'arithmétique binaire ?
Dans l'arithmétique BCD, chaque chiffre décimal est traité comme une entité distincte et les opérations arithmétiques sont effectuées sur chaque chiffre individuellement. Dans l'arithmétique binaire, le nombre binaire entier est traité comme une entité unique et les opérations arithmétiques sont effectuées sur le nombre entier.
Quel est l'objectif de la conversion du BCD en 7 segments ?
La conversion BCD à 7 segments est un processus utilisé pour afficher des nombres codés en BCD sur un écran à 7 segments. Un afficheur à 7 segments est un type de dispositif d'affichage électronique qui peut afficher des chiffres décimaux et certaines lettres et symboles à l'aide de sept segments disposés selon un certain schéma.
À quoi servent les additionneurs BCD ?
Les additionneurs BCD sont des circuits numériques utilisés pour effectuer des opérations arithmétiques sur des nombres codés en BCD. Les additionneurs BCD peuvent additionner ou soustraire deux nombres BCD et produire un résultat au format BCD.
En quoi le code BCD diffère-t-il du code gris en termes de motifs de bits ?
Le code gris est un système de numération binaire dans lequel les valeurs successives ne diffèrent que d'un bit, tandis que le BCD est un système de numération décimal dans lequel chaque chiffre décimal est représenté par quatre bits. Le code gris possède un schéma binaire spécifique conçu pour réduire les erreurs causées par les transitions entre des valeurs adjacentes, alors que le BCD ne possède pas cette caractéristique.
Quelle est la différence entre le code BCD et le code excess-127 ?
Le code excess-127, également connu sous le nom de format à virgule flottante 8 bits, est une variante du code BCD dans laquelle l'exposant est représenté sous la forme excess-127 et la mantisse est représentée au format BCD. Cela permet au nombre codé en BCD de représenter une plus large gamme de valeurs que le BCD traditionnel.
En quoi le code BCD diffère-t-il du code ASCII en termes de transmission de données ?
Le code BCD est un système de représentation numérique utilisé pour représenter des chiffres décimaux, tandis que le code ASCII est un système de codage de caractères utilisé pour représenter des données textuelles. Le code BCD ne peut pas représenter des caractères, des symboles ou d'autres types de données, alors que le code ASCII peut représenter tous ces types de données.
Quel est l'objectif de la conversion BCD-décimal ?
La conversion BCD-décimal est un processus utilisé pour convertir un nombre codé en BCD en son équivalent décimal. Cette opération est utile lorsque l'on travaille avec des données codées en BCD dans des applications nécessitant une représentation décimale.
Quel est l'objectif de la conversion du code BCD en code ASCII (American Standard Code for Information Interchange) ?
La conversion BCD-ASCII est un processus utilisé pour convertir un nombre codé en BCD en sa représentation ASCII. Cette opération est utile lorsque l'on travaille avec des données codées en BCD dans des applications nécessitant une représentation textuelle.